DataX Connect have partnered with a leading MEP contractor in their search for an MEP Preconstruction Engineer to join their head office in London.

Why Apply?

  • Great salary and package
  • Work for a fast growing forward thinking contractor
  • Step off site to gain experience in the world of data centre preconstruction

Key Requirements:

  • Experience within an M&E environment preferred, electrical knowledge essential.
  • Sector and industry knowledge within the Data Centre and associated services environment.
  • IT skills and use of Microsoft applications (Word, Excel, Project and PowerPoint – Intermediate / advanced level)
  • Financial awareness of profit and loss and commercial costing.
  • Good time management and prioritisation skills, with a results-oriented ethos.
  • To have completed the relevant levels of qualification that are relevant to the sector and industry.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Remain up to date with the Company’s health, safety, and environmental statistics relative to industry benchmarks to demonstrate our credibility and influence current/prospective clients, as well as incorporate safety within tender processes.
  • Work with the Senior management to identify and convert winning opportunities into profitable contracts, in line with business strategy.
  • Ownership of assigned bids and, where necessary, early engagement involving supply chain stakeholders to meet timescales.
  • Ensure accuracy of estimated cost, through detailed review, lead and undertake peer review with teams and senior management. Present cost and sales values, while capturing any risks and opportunities at final settlement.
  • Maintain sales pipeline data on completion of bid submission using coordinated management tools in line with business process.
  • Manage the production of allocated bid submissions to ensure that: our differentiators are communicated effectively, submission documents are completed on time, fully respond to formal and informal questions posed in the customers’ enquiry documentation and meet the requirements of the Invitation to Tender.
  • Demonstrates sound understanding of software applications relevant to the job role and utilises technology to improve work processes.
  • Uses technology to share information, communicate and collaborate.
  • Establishes and develops a wide internal and external network supporting tendering and winning objectives.
  • Demonstrates effective management and maintenance of third-party / supply chain relationships that are cost-effective and provide efficient service where applicable.
  • Identifies ways to gain a competitive advantage through the delivery of superior levels of service.
  • Leads secured bid handovers, ensuring the transition of knowledge has been recorded, received, and understood.
  • Actively support the project teams so they fully understand the client design specification, build, suppliers’ quotations, and customer requirements, enabling successful delivery.
